70 V/µs Slew Rate, 15 MHz GBP — Signal Chain Fit
The LM318MX/NOPB is a single-channel general-purpose operational amplifier from Texas Instruments, specified with a 70 V/µs slew rate and a 15 MHz gain-bandwidth product (GBP). The -3 dB bandwidth is also 15 MHz, so the GBP figure is the one that governs closed-loop gain-bandwidth trade-offs — at a gain of 10, the usable signal bandwidth is roughly 1.5 MHz before the open-loop gain rolls off. Input offset voltage is 4 mV maximum, and input bias current is 150 nA — both DC precision specs that matter when the amplifier drives a downstream ADC or a precision reference. Supply current is 5 mA, which is modest for this speed class; the supply range spans 10 V to 40 V total (single or split supplies), giving flexibility across ±5 V to ±20 V rails.
8-SOIC Package and 0°C to 70°C Temperature Grade
Housed in an 8-SOIC package (0.154-inch body width, 3.90 mm), the LM318MX/NOPB is a surface-mount device with a standard SOIC-8 footprint. The supplier device package is also 8-SOIC, so no footprint variation between the two identifiers. Operating temperature range is 0°C to 70°C — commercial grade. This limits deployment to indoor, temperature-controlled environments; not rated for industrial or automotive ambient extremes.
Active Lifecycle, ROHS3, and Packaging Options
Texas Instruments lists the LM318MX/NOPB as Active with ROHS3 compliance. Available in Tape & Reel (TR) or Cut Tape (CT) packaging — the TR option suits automated pick-and-place assembly, while CT works for prototype or low-volume builds.
